Xavier Deneux is the author of My Animals (2009), TouchThinkLearn: 123 (2018), TouchThinkLearn: ABC (Baby Board Books, Baby Touch and Feel Books, Sensory Books for Toddlers) (2016), TouchThinkLearn: Numbers (2014), TouchThinkLearn: Feelings (2020).

TouchThinkLearn: Numbers

release date: May 27, 2014
TouchThinkLearn: Numbers
Combining scooped-out die-cuts with raised, shaped elements, two new TouchThinkLearn books offer youngest learners an irresistible opportunity to explore their universe in a hands-on, multisensory way. See the image, trace its shape, say its name: these modes of perception combine in a dynamic way to stimulate understanding of essential concepts. Experience the number "2" both by counting a pair of raised car wheels on one side, and feeling its shape on the other. Featuring a format unlike any other, these groundbreaking books translate abstract thought into tangible knowledge.

My Circus

release date: May 01, 2010
My Circus
Xavier Deneux turns another simple concept book into high art-this time treating readers to the wonders of the circus. Perfect for babies and toddlers, My Circus introduces clowns, magicians, trapeze artists, and many more familiar stars of the big top. With an irresistible foam cover, high-contrast palette with bright splashes of color, and playful die-cuts, this adorable board book is sure to grab the attention of the youngest book lovers and circus goers.

MIS ANIMALES SUAVECITOS

release date: Apr 01, 2015
MIS ANIMALES SUAVECITOS
Un libro en blanco y negro con animales y muchas texturas para estimular la vista, el tacto y la imaginación. El gato sigue al ratón en silencio, entre las hojas, el panda juega con las mariposas, sobre el hielo, el osito polar espera a su mamá... Dirigido a los más pequeños, este hermoso álbum ilustrado permite introducir a los niños y las niñas al mundo de libro. Además de constituir un material didáctico de primera calidad, representa un buen pretexto para que los papás compartan con sus hijos muchos momentos de afecto, aprendizaje y conocimiento del lenguaje. Es una obra llena de ternura que combina imágenes, texturas y palabras. Ideal para la hora de ir a dormir. This black-and-white book features animals and lots of textures to stimulate sight, touch, and imagination. The cat pursues the rat in silence; in the leaves, the panda bear plays with butterflies; on the ice, the polar bear waits for its mother. Intended for babies, this beautiful illustrated book introduces children to the world of reading. It''s an ideal book for bedtime and combines images, textures, and words to encourage sharing between parents and children.
